Coast Artillery Battery, Underwater Ranging, Harbor Defense
1 November 1940
Table of Organization 4-227
1. Battery Headquarters Section
2. Operating Platoon
2.1 Range Section
2.2 Listener Section
2.3 Echo-Ranging Section
Total Platoon: 2 Officers, 56 Enlisted, 2 Pistols, 56 Rifles, 1 Plotting listening room, 1 Plotting echo-ranging room, 2 Hydrophone stations, 1 Echo-ranging station
3. Mine Yawl Section
4. Maintenance Section
Total Compahy: 4 Officers, 79 Enlisted, 9 Pistols, 74 Rifles, 1 Plotting listening room, 1 Plotting echo-ranging room, 2 Hydrophone stations, 1 Echo-ranging station
Note:
- This battery is a special organization and is not normally found in harbor defense regiment. When required in a harbor defense, it will be added to a regiment stationed thereat as an additional battery and the regimental organization increased accordingly.
- 4 Officers = 1 Captain + 1 1st Lieutenant + 2 2nd Lieutenants;
- 79 Enlisted = 1 First Sergeant + 1 Staff Sergeant + 12 Sergeants + 19 Corporals + 16 Privates First Class + 30 Privates;
